Elevating Canned Baked Beans with Easy Additions
Enhancing canned baked beans can be as simple as adding a few ingredients to the pot. Here are some popular additions suggested by Reddit users:
- Bacon or Pancetta: Crumbling cooked bacon into the beans adds a smoky, savory flavor that complements the sweetness of the beans and tomato sauce.
- Chili Flakes or Hot Sauce: For those who enjoy a bit of heat, adding chili flakes or a few dashes of hot sauce can significantly elevate the flavor profile of the dish.

How can I add depth and complexity to canned baked beans?
To add depth and complexity to canned baked beans, one can start by introducing new ingredients and spices to the recipe. This can include adding aromatics such as onions, garlic, and bell peppers, which can be sautéed before adding the beans to create a rich and savory flavor base. Additionally, spices and herbs like smoked paprika, cumin, and thyme can be added to give the beans a smoky and earthy flavor. Other ingredients like diced tomatoes, chipotle peppers, or bourbon can also be added to create a more complex and interesting flavor profile.
By experimenting with different combinations of ingredients and spices, one can create a unique and personalized flavor profile for canned baked beans. It’s also important to consider the cooking method, as slow cooking or braising the beans can help to develop a richer and more intense flavor. What role does acidity play in balancing the flavors of baked beans?
Acidity plays a crucial role in balancing the flavors of baked beans, as it helps to cut through the richness and sweetness of the dish. A splash of vinegar, such as apple cider or balsamic, can add a tangy and bright flavor to the beans, while also helping to balance the pH levels. Additionally, acidic ingredients like tomatoes or citrus juice can help to enhance the flavors of the other ingredients and create a more harmonious taste experience. By incorporating acidic elements, one can create a more balanced and refined flavor profile for baked beans.
The key to using acidity effectively in baked beans is to find the right balance between sweet, sour, and savory flavors. Too much acidity can make the dish taste sharp or unpleasant, while too little can result in a dull and uninspiring flavor. According to Reddit users, a good starting point is to add a small amount of acidity, such as a tablespoon of vinegar, and then adjust to taste. It’s also important to consider the type of acidity, as different ingredients can produce distinct flavor profiles. For example, apple cider vinegar can add a fruity and mellow flavor, while balsamic vinegar can produce a more intense and tangy taste.
Can I use alternative types of beans to make baked beans?
Yes, it’s possible to use alternative types of beans to make baked beans, and many people prefer to use dried beans or other varieties for their unique flavor and texture. Some popular alternatives to traditional navy beans include pinto beans, kidney beans, and black beans, which can add a slightly sweet and earthy flavor to the dish. Additionally, using heirloom or heritage beans can provide a more complex and nuanced flavor profile, as well as a higher nutritional content. By experimenting with different types of beans, one can create a personalized and distinctive flavor profile for baked beans.
When using alternative types of beans, it’s essential to consider the cooking time and method, as different varieties can have distinct cooking requirements. For example, dried beans may need to be soaked overnight and then cooked for an extended period, while canned beans can be used straight away. What are some creative ways to serve baked beans as a main course?
Baked beans can be served as a main course in a variety of creative ways, from traditional comfort food dishes to more innovative and modern recipes. One popular idea is to serve baked beans as a filling for sandwiches or wraps, paired with ingredients like barbecue pork, coleslaw, or pickles. Alternatively, baked beans can be used as a topping for baked potatoes, grilled meats, or vegetables, adding a rich and savory flavor to the dish. According to Reddit users, some other creative ways to serve baked beans include using them as a filling for stuffed bell peppers, as a sauce for grilled cheese sandwiches, or as a side dish for breakfast or brunch.
By thinking outside the box and experimenting with different ingredients and presentation styles, you can transform baked beans into a satisfying and filling main course. Some other ideas include serving baked beans with crispy bacon, scrambled eggs, and toast for a hearty breakfast dish, or using them as a sauce for nachos or tacos.
